(St. Leon, Ind.) - Two-time state championship winning quarterback Cole Burton has found a home at the collegiate level.
The East Central High School senior announced his commitment to Ohio Dominican University on Tuesday afternoon.
Burton, a three-year starter, will leave East Central as one of the top quarterbacks in program history. For his career, he threw for 4,862 yards and a school record 62 touchdowns.
As a senior, Burton 1,319 yards and 21 touchdowns, and fell just short of breaking the school record for completion percentage at 67 percent. Head coach Jake Meiners currently holds the record at 69 percent.
Another career milestone for Burton includes being a two-time captain. Only four players in program history have earned the honor of being a multi-year captain.
